The Volume-Time Curve by Three-Dimensional Echocardiography in Chagas Cardiomyopathy: Insights into the Mechanism of Hemodynamic Adaptations.

Airandes de Sousa PintoMaria do Carmo Pereira NunesCarlos Alberto RodriguesBráulio Muzzi Ribeiro de OliveiraJoão da Rocha Medrado NetoTimothy C TanManoel Otávio da Costa Rocha
Published in: Arquivos brasileiros de cardiologia (2022)
Using a non-invasive tool, we demonstrated that an increase in LV end-diastolic volume may be the main adaptation mechanism that maintains the flow and stroke volumes in the setting of severe LV systolic dysfunction.
